A local healthcare provider in Cannock is seeking a Care Coordinator to enhance the care service for patients. The role involves working with Health Professionals to create personalized care plans, support patients, and improve health service access.
Ideal candidates will have prior experience in healthcare, strong communication skills, and IT proficiency. This opportunity offers a platform to contribute meaningfully to health improvement in the community, with a focus on supporting vulnerable groups in managing their health effectively.
